Comprehending Cold Laser Therapy



To understand cold laser treatment, you must understand the fundamental principles behind this non-invasive therapy technique. Cold laser treatment, additionally referred to as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), makes use of specific wavelengths of light to connect with tissue. The light energy permeates the skin and is taken in by cells, triggering a collection of biological responses. These reactions assist promote recovery, lower swelling, and reduce pain.


The essential to comprehending cold laser treatment depends on its capability to promote cellular function. When the light power is absorbed by cells, it improves their metabolic process and speeds up the manufacturing of ATP, the energy resource for cells. This boost in cellular activity can result in boosted circulation, tissue fixing, and pain relief.

Benefits of Cold Laser Therapy



Utilizing particular wavelengths of light, cold laser therapy supplies a series of benefits for discomfort alleviation and healing. Among the essential advantages of cold laser therapy is its non-invasive nature. Unlike surgeries, cold laser therapy doesn't require incisions, making it a more secure and much more comfortable option for many patients.

Additionally, cold laser treatment is understood for its capability to decrease inflammation. By targeting irritated locations with concentrated light power, the therapy assists to lower swelling and advertise quicker recovery.

In addition, cold laser treatment is a prominent choice because of its marginal negative effects. Unlike some drugs that can create adverse responses, cold laser treatment is mild on the body and usually well-tolerated. This makes it an ideal option for people searching for an all-natural and low-risk discomfort relief option.

One more substantial advantage is the quick healing time related to cold laser therapy. Since the therapy boosts the body's all-natural recovery procedures, people usually experience quick renovations in their condition without the need for prolonged downtime.
